public class RmCommand extends GitCommand<DirCache>
It has setters for all supported options and arguments of this command and a
call() method to finally execute the command. Each instance of this
class should only be used for one invocation of the command (means: one call
to call()).
Examples (git is a Git instance):
Remove file "test.txt" from both index and working directory:
git.rm().addFilepattern("test.txt").call();
Remove file "new.txt" from the index (but not from the working directory):
git.rm().setCached(true).addFilepattern("new.txt").call();
